1. Explore the Parks

Terre Haute is home to several beautiful parks where students can unwind, have a picnic, or engage in outdoor activities. Here are some popular parks to check out:

  • Deming Park: Offers walking trails, picnic areas, and sports facilities. Perfect for a relaxing day outdoors.
  • Fairbanks Park: Located along the Wabash River, this park features scenic views, a play area, and walking paths.
  • Vigo County Arboretum: A peaceful spot for nature lovers, featuring a variety of trees and plants to explore.

2. Visit Local Museums

Enhance your cultural experience by visiting local artistic and historical sites. Many museums offer free admission or student discounts:

  • The Terre Haute Children’s Museum: While primarily aimed at younger audiences, students can enjoy interactive exhibits for just a small fee, and special events sometimes offer complimentary entry.
  • Swope Art Museum: Home to several impressive collections, this museum is free to the public and offers a serene environment to appreciate art.
  • Indiana State University Gallery: Offers various exhibits throughout the year, with free entries to students.

3. Attend Local Events

Keep an eye on the community calendar for local events that often celebrate arts, culture, and community spirit. Here are some must-see events:

  • First Friday: A monthly arts event featuring local artists, live music, and food trucks. Enjoy the community vibe and support local talent.
  • Terre Haute Farmers Market: Held on Saturdays, it’s a great place to find local produce and handmade goods while enjoying live music and community spirit.
  • Holiday Events: During the festive seasons, various free events such as parades and festivals take place, bringing joy to the community and students alike.
